As with any major disaster , Dieringer details that while short term digital strategies and transformation projects may be put on hold in order to focus on the prevention of COVID-19 , looking to the future Dieringer believes that “ companies will take time to take stock and develop new plans and strategies to begin the first tentative steps to recovery ,” and “ cloud computing will play an essential role in that recovery . For companies already adept at using cloud , they will look at additional ways of utilising it further . Those yet to embrace will undoubtedly implement the many cost savings , and ease of working it affords .”
